    Medicine Hat Tigers 2024 Center Ice and Rink Layout at CO-OP Place - WHL 2025 Graphics Report an Error 2023 COOP Place COOP Place Interior COOP Place Interior Credit: Medicine Hat Tigers COOP Place 1/3 CO-OP Place Medicine Hat, AB Canada Rink Dimensions 200x85 Feet Co-op Place is a 7,100-seat indoor arena located in Medicine Hat, Alberta, Canada. It opened on August 22, 2015 as the new home of the Medicine Hat Tigers of the Western Hockey League, replacing the Medicine Hat Arena.     Calgary Flames 2020 Center Ice and Rink Layout at Scotiabank Saddledome - NHL 2021 Graphics Report an Error 2019 Scotiabank Saddledome Scotiabank Saddledome Interior Credit: The Globe and Mail Olympic Saddledome Construction Credit: Canadian Geographic Scotiabank Saddledome 1/5 Scotiabank Saddledome Calgary, AB Canada Rink Dimensions 200x85 Feet Scotiabank Saddledome is a multi-use indoor arena in Calgary, Alberta, Canada. Located in Stampede Park in the southeast end of downtown Calgary, the Saddledome was built in 1983 to replace the Stampede Corral as the home of the Calgary Flames of the National Hockey League, and to host ice hockey and figure skating at the 1988 Winter Olympics.     Huntsville Havoc 2017 Center Ice and Rink Layout at Von Braun Center - SPHL 2018 Graphics Missing Ads Report an Error 2016 Von Braun Center Credit: Von Braun Center Von Braun Center Credit: WHNT.com Von Braun Center Interior Von Braun Center Credit: Von Braun Center 1/4 Von Braun Center Huntsville, AL USA Rink Dimensions 200x85 Feet The Von Braun Center is an entertainment complex, with a maximum arena seating capacity of 9,000, located in Huntsville, Alabama. The original facility debuted in 1975 and has undergone several significant expansions since its opening. Propst Arena within the complex seats 9,000 for hockey.
